WebAmerican Gothic is a 1930 painting by Grant Wood in the collection of the Art Institute of Chicago.Wood was inspired to paint what is now known as the American Gothic House in Eldon, Iowa, along with "the kind of people [he] fancied should live in that house".It depicts a farmer standing beside his daughter – often mistakenly assumed to be his wife. WebThe Art Institute of Chicago in Chicago's Grant Park, founded in 1879, is one of the oldest and largest art museums in the world. WebThe Art Institute of Chicago is one of the world’s great encyclopedic art museums. Its collection of more than 300,000 artworks covers the history of art across multiple cultures and eras.
